30th January 2011, 03:17 PM #9 We have a couple of regular suppliers who I play off against each other to get the best paper I can as I find the cheaper stuff just jams printers constantly which is very annoying from our point of view.
Every time I find a good paper however it soon goes up in price so I keep an eye out for when its back on offer or a good price and then order 2 pallets of it. We get through about 3 pallets a term, but that has dropped a bit since we put in Print Management, so we only used 2 pallets last term which was great
So that was 40 boxes less.
The last lot I got I bought direct from the mill which was a good way of doing it, there area couple of firms now that work for the mills and just resell direct from them so you have no storage costs or anything put on which does bring the cost down a few pence a ream which on 40 boxes does help

30th January 2011, 04:49 PM #11 Also something to remember is that copiers and printers don't really like having the make of paper changed if you've been using only one type for a while. We did this a while back, switching from a single regular supplier to random suppliers with whoever is cheapest getting the deal when we need some, and that change caused us to have to change a bunch of pickup rollers on machines all over the place. Our copiers definitely don't like it.
